About this home

Charming Cabin Retreat Near Lake Arrowhead Village – Optional Dock Available! Discover the perfect blend of rustic charm and modern convenience in this cozy cabin, just a short walk from Lake Arrowhead Village. Nestled on a beautifully maintained private road, with neighbors contributing to snow removal, this home offers year-round accessibility and ample parking, including a two-car garage and additional street parking. Step inside and instantly feel the warmth of this inviting mountain retreat. The grand foyer leads to a spacious living area, featuring a cozy brick fireplace, T&G ceilings, neutral walls, and wood flooring that flows seamlessly into the dining area. The kitchen boasts rustic wood cabinetry, a butcher block island, and a charming retro oversized stove, with an adjacent laundry/pantry room for added convenience. The main level includes an expansive deck where you can relax and take in the lush forest views. A generously sized bedroom suite is also located on this level. All bedrooms and bathrooms throughout the home are oversized, providing ample comfort for family and guests. Downstairs, the entertainment room is the perfect gathering space, complete with a bar area and a wine cellar. The outdoor areas are equally impressive, offering multiple spaces for entertaining and soaking in the breathtaking forest scenery. The partially fenced yard adds to the home’s privacy and charm. Recent upgrades include a full repiping with Pex A piping and a tankless water heater (installed May 2022), as well as a newer natural gas Generac generator with a backup battery (installed 2018) for peace of mind. Currently operating as a successful vacation rental, the home is consistently booked on weekends—weekday viewings are recommended. A dock is also available for an additional cost.
